#VU55862 Code Injection in Contao


Published: 2021-08-16

Vulnerability identifier: #VU55862

Vulnerability risk: Low

CVSSv3.1: 6.3 [C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:H/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H/E:U/RL:O/RC:C]

CVE-ID: CVE-2021-37626

CWE-ID: CWE-94

Exploitation vector: Network

Exploit availability: No

Vulnerable software:
Contao
Web applications / CMS

Vendor: Contao

Description

The vulnerability allows a remote local to execute arbitrary code on the target system.

The vulnerability exists due to improper input validation. A remote administrator can load PHP files and execute arbitrary code on the target system.

Successful exploitation of this vulnerability may result in complete compromise of vulnerable system.

Mitigation
Install updates from vendor's website.

Vulnerable software versions

Contao: 4.4.0 - 4.11.6
